OCTOPUS

FAMILY

PROJECT TYPE finger knitting

SKILL LEVEL beginner

TECHNIQUES

Casting on

Two-finger knitting

Binding off

Cutting a finger-knit strand

Weaving in ends

materials

38 yd (34.5m) of “slim” or “mid” super-bulky yarn per octopus,

Scissors

Stuffing or cotton balls

Buttons (approximately 10 mm)

Sewing needle and thread

Contrasting yarn and darning needle, for French-knot eyes (if preferred)

Ribbon or fabric for bow tie

See here for an explanation of super-bulky yarns.

yarn used

1 skein Madelinetosh ASAP in Courbet’s Green, Betty Draper Blue, or Cricket, 90 yd (82m), 4½ oz (127g), 100% superwash merino wool

sizes & measurements

BIG: 3" (7.5cm) wide, 10" (25.5cm) long or 3¼" (8.5cm) tall in sitting position

BABY: 2½" (6.5cm) wide, 7½" (19cm) long or 2¾" (7cm) tall in sitting position

The big octopi’s bow ties are fabric cut to 14½" × 1½" (37cm × 3.8cm) and hemmed ¼" (6mm) all the way around. The baby’s tie is simply a raw-edged piece of fabric cut to 10" × ½" (25.5cm × 13mm). Ribbon or a piece of felt, or even a scrap of contrasting yarn, would work well, too.

note

Replace the buttons with French-Knot (see Appendix) eyes to make this sea buddy safe for infants.

1. Finger knit a two-finger strand until it measures approximately 2½ yd (2.3m) for the adult or 2 yd (1.8m) for the baby. Bind off.

2. Cut the strand into four 21" (53.5cm) pieces for the adult or four 17" (43cm) pieces for the baby. Refinish cut strand (see Cutting a Finger-Knit Strand) (A). Weave all ends into the strand and trim.
